Learn more about Office Administration Masters degree programs in USA
Students interested in a career in a busy business environment may want to consider the study of office administration. This course of study is designed to enhance inter-office communication skills, improve customer relations and equip students with stress-management tools.
The USA is home to some of the world's top universities. Students can expect a diverse, innovative, and engaging student experience. The country emphasizes accessibility and quality independent research, allowing students to push the limits of their field should they want to.
American English is extremely dominant in the USA, so classes will likely be in English, with a few exceptions. This means that many schools will ask for proof of English proficiency through the TOEFL iBT test before admitting international students.
